Understanding the Key Fob
A key fob is a little electronic gadget that permits the owner of a lorry to lock and open the doors, begin the engine, and perform other functions without the requirement for a traditional key. For Citroën Dispatch owners, the key fob typically comes equipped with vital features such as remote locking and unlocking, panic alarm, and often even a built-in immobilizer that includes an extra layer of security.

Before proceeding with replacement, it's important to identify whether the key fob is really malfunctioning. Common signs include:
Inconsistent Performance: The fob only works sporadically or requires multiple presses to function.Physical Damage: The key fob reveals signs of wear and tear, such as fractures or loose buttons.Battery Issues: A dead battery can cause the fob to stop working entirely, demanding a basic battery replacement rather than a full fob replacement.
If the above signs are evident, it might be time to think about a replacement.
